Safr'Inside™ for sleep: NutraIngredients finalist

Activ'Inside is also celebrating Safr'Inside™ as a 2025 NutraIngredients Awards ingredient finalist in the "Mind and Mood" category. This patented, full-spectrum saffron extract is already known for its emotional balance and destressing benefits, but it is now making waves in the sleep sector. Two recently published clinical studies have demonstrated Safr'Inside™'s ability to significantly improve sleep quality by targeting the gut–sleep–brain axis in addition, to work at a small dose of 20mg in only 21 days. The extract is rich in safranal (0.2% HPLC), a vital component often lost in traditional saffron extraction processes, making Safr'Inside™ one of the most potent natural sleep aids available today.

Belight3™: Winner of the "Beauty from within" award

At Supply Side Global, Activ'Inside will also spotlight Belight3™, which has won the 2025 NutraIngredients “Beauty From Within” Award. A winner of the prestigious Nutraingredients Award 2025 under the beauty from within category, Belightᵌ™ is a patented combination of grape seed, licorice, and grape pomace extracts with coated Vitamin C, shown to inhibit tyrosinase production by 85%. Clinically tested on both Asian and Caucasian skin, it delivers visibly brighter, more even complexions with high consumer satisfaction and visible results as early as 11 days.

Hair'Inside™: Recently submitted clinical study

Exciting news for Hair'Inside™ Activ'Inside will present a soon-to-be-published clinical study that further supports the efficacy of this revitalizing hair formula. This upcoming study promises to reinforce its status as one of the effective solutions in the hair health market which not only focuses on hair loss but overall hair beauty. The study, which involved a multicenter, randomized, double-blind, placebo-controlled clinical trial on 66 healthy women, demonstrated that after just 42 days of daily supplementation with 280 mg of Hair'Inside™, participants saw a significant increase in hair density, an unprecedented speed for a nutricosmetic formula. After 84 days, hair loss had been reduced by 51.3%, with a notable improvement in hair brightness by 17%.

Cellulite: Launching Celluvine™ in the US.

Cellulite affects 80–90% of American women, making it a major beauty concern(1). Activ’Inside is introducing Celluvine™, a patented formula that targets the root causes of cellulite—impaired circulation, fat cells hypertrophy, and oxidative stress. In a real-world study of 40 women, daily supplementation led to visible improvements: orange peel skin was reduced by 22%, 88% reduced body fat by an average of 12.4%, 98% saw reduced circumference in at least one area, and 80% lost an average of 2.3 kg. Remarkably, these benefits lasted for a month after stopping, providing lasting, science-backed results for firmer, smoother skin.
